Product Overview

The OPB771NZ is a reflective object sensor belonging to the category of optoelectronic devices. It is commonly used for detecting the presence or absence of objects, and it possesses unique characteristics that make it suitable for various applications. The sensor is typically packaged in a compact housing and is available in different packaging quantities to cater to diverse user requirements.

Working Principles

The OPB771NZ operates based on the principle of reflective sensing, where it emits light and detects the reflection from an object to determine its presence or absence.

  1. What is OPB771NZ?

    • OPB771NZ is a reflective object sensor that consists of an infrared LED and a phototransistor.
  2. What are the typical applications of OPB771NZ?

    • OPB771NZ is commonly used in applications such as paper detection in printers, edge sensing in robotics, and object detection in industrial automation.
  3. What is the operating voltage range for OPB771NZ?

    • The operating voltage range for OPB771NZ is typically between 4.5V to 5.5V.
  4. How does OPB771NZ detect objects?

    • OPB771NZ detects objects by emitting infrared light from the LED and then measuring the amount of light reflected back to the phototransistor.
  5. What is the sensing distance of OPB771NZ?

    • The sensing distance of OPB771NZ is typically around 0.2 inches to 0.5 inches, depending on the reflectivity of the object.
  6. Can OPB771NZ be used in outdoor environments?

    • OPB771NZ is not recommended for outdoor use as it is designed for indoor applications and may be affected by ambient light and environmental conditions.
  7. What is the output type of OPB771NZ?

    • OPB771NZ provides a digital output, which switches from high to low when an object is detected within its sensing range.
  8. Is OPB771NZ sensitive to ambient light?

    • OPB771NZ is designed to minimize the effects of ambient light, but it may still be affected by very bright or direct sunlight.
  9. Can OPB771NZ be used with microcontrollers?

    • Yes, OPB771NZ can be easily interfaced with microcontrollers and other digital logic circuits for integration into larger systems.
  10. What are the key considerations for mounting OPB771NZ?

    • When mounting OPB771NZ, it's important to ensure proper alignment between the sensor and the target object, as well as to minimize any potential obstructions or reflections that could affect its performance.
